2001 Chrysler Sebring Convertible engine and engine cooling problems

62 owner complaints filed with NHTSA name the engine and engine cooling on the 2001 Chrysler Sebring Convertible52% of all complaints for this model year.

What owners report

  • Tl*the contact owns a 2001 chrysler sebring convertible. While driving approximately 25 mph, the engine stalled without prior warning. The vehicle was towed to an authorized dealer and the engine was replaced. Three years later, the identical failure recurred and the vehicle was not repaired. The…

  • This is another example of the oil sludge issue with the chrysler 2.7 l engine. I bought the car used with low miles, and had my tension arm go out a few months later due to sludge buildup. This second instance came up pretty quickly. The started knocking on hard acceleration, then 2 days later…
